SUMMARY
Gelling agent is the main ingredient in gel manufacture. The gel preparation that is widely used by the community is the hand saitizer gel, where the hand sanitizer gel is a preparation that can clean hands from bacteria. One of the gelling agents that is widely used is carbopol 940. The development of carbopol 940 which can be relied on by the ionization process so that TEA is needed as a pH stabilizer. The purpose of this study was to measure the appropriate concentration of carbopol 940 and TEA so that the evaluation of the dosage was good. The method used is an experimental method. The 940 carbopol concentrations used were 0.3 grams, 0.4 grams, and 0.5 grams, while the TEA concentrations were 0.4 grams, 0.6 grams, and 0.8 grams. The results showed that all formulas were in accordance with the evaluation requirements including the organoleptic test, pH test, viscosity test, spreadability test, and adhesion test. However, of the three formulas, the evaluation results of the preparations that match the hand sanitizer gel on the market are formula 3 with a carobopol 940 concentration of 0.5 grams and a TEA of 0.8 grams.
